Harris County Sheriff Looking For Capital Murder Suspect
The Harris County Sheriff's Office is looking for a man wanted for capital murder.

Houston, TX -- Yo, you seen Frederick Donnell Foster? The Harris County Sheriff is looking for him.
Five-Oh thinks Foster was involved in a kick-in robbery that went way south. At around 5:30 a.m. on Saturday, June 25, at least two guys went to an apartment complex in the 1000 block of Cypress Station Drive, out by I-45 and Cypress Creek Parkway.

The two guys went to Robert Russo's apartment and, allegedly tried to rob him. Russo, 64, caught a bullet and died during the robbery, but it looks like he tagged one of the bad guys before he went down.
Homicide followed a blood trail from Russo's apartment to the complex's back fence and found Michael Brown, 26, laying next to a ski mask with a bullet in his side.

Brown was taken to a hospital and treated for the gunshot wound. He's in stable condition and, apparently, talking.
The sheriff's office is being pretty cagey with the details. They haven't said exactly what part Foster might have played in the robbery or even if he was at the scene. They just said he's wanted.
